How to fill out the Affidavit Modello online
Filling out the Affidavit Modello online is an essential step in confirming your status as a non-foreign person regarding property transfer. This guide will provide you with clear instructions to ensure you complete the form accurately and efficiently.
Follow the steps to complete the Affidavit Modello
-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
- Begin by entering your name as the seller in the designated section. It is crucial to provide the full legal name, as it will be used in the affidavit.
- Next, provide the details of the property being transferred. Include the complete address, city, county, and state, along with the district, section, block, township, and range information.
- Fill in your United States taxpayer identification number. You must list your tax ID number next to your name and include your full address details including city, state, and zip code.
- If there are multiple sellers, repeat the process by including each seller's name, tax ID number, and address as per the designated sections.
- In the next section, confirm your status as a non-foreign person as defined in the legal terms. This is a critical step for the exemption from withholding.
- Indicate the name of the buyer or transferee for whom the affidavit is being prepared to finalize this section.
- Each seller must sign and date the affidavit at the end of the form. Ensure that all signatures are clear and the dates are accurate.
- Lastly, if a notary public is required, ensure it is properly signed and stamped. Review the completed form for any errors or omissions before finalizing.
